The accelerating advance of automation is dramatically impacting industries across the globe. From manufacturing and shipping to medical services and banking , machines and artificial intelligence are performing tasks previously done by human workers . This shift is driving increased output, reducing expenses , and generating new possibilities while also presenting questions regarding the future of the workforce and the imperative for retraining initiatives.

The Future of Work in an Automated World
The changing scene of work is set to be drastically transformed by artificial intelligence. While worries about widespread job displacement are justified, the reality is likely to be more multifaceted. We can foresee a future where people and robots partner – requiring a focus on upskilling the workforce and nurturing uniquely personal skills like innovation and social awareness. The challenge lies in addressing this transition successfully and making that the benefits of automation are distributed fairly across the population.
Ethical Considerations in Automation Implementation
The increasing adoption of robotic process automation presents significant ethical challenges that need be carefully addressed . These cover potential job reduction, the development of biased decision-making processes, and the weakening of individual independence . It is essential that companies prioritize ethical development and use of these technologies, ensuring accountability and reducing potential negative impacts on communities and the employees .
Demystifying Automation: Benefits and Challenges
Widespread process automation is transforming industries, but it’s often surrounded by confusion. Let's look at the advantages and potential challenges.
- Improving output: Automation can handle tasks more quickly and with reduced errors.
- Lowering costs: While the upfront investment can be substantial, automation often produces long-term reductions.
- Improving consistency: Robotic processes tend to be consistently accurate.
- Job displacement: Concerns about employees losing their positions are justified.
- Substantial starting expenses: Implementing automation can be pricy.
- Challenges in integration: Integrating automation with existing systems can be challenging.
